Summary
Overview
Work History
Education
Skills
Languages
Personal Information
Timeline
Generic

Himanshu Gupta

Bangalore

Summary

Dynamic Software Quality Engineer with extensive experience at McAfee Software India Pvt. Ltd., excelling in Python automation scripting and functional testing. Proven track record in enhancing test frameworks and ensuring system stability. Adept at collaborating with cross-functional teams, driving project success through effective communication and innovative problem-solving.

Overview

6
6
years of professional experience

Work History

Software Quality Engineer

McAfee Software India Pvt. Ltd
Bangalore
06.2021 - Current
  • Performed manual execution of static and dynamic malware samples to validate heuristic rule effectiveness and monitor system behavior
  • Utilized Process Hacker, Procmon, and SeaLighter to analyze runtime activities
  • Conducted in-depth log analysis to verify system stability during prolonged testing cycles
  • Developed Python automation frameworks for performance benchmarking and sanity validations
  • Exclusively worked in Windows VMware environments
  • Used Django in automation framework
  • Executed Sanity, Performance, Functional, Regression, and Unit testing
  • Maintained and updated test cases and Python libraries for new feature support

Software QA Engineer

McAfee Software India Pvt. Ltd
Bangalore
06.2021 - 03.2023
  • Feasibility study and analysis of automation test case
  • To read all the documents and understand what needs to be tested
  • Execute all levels of testing (Sanity, Performance, Functional and Regression, Unit testing)
  • Carry out regression testing every time when changes are made to the code to fix defects
  • Based on the information procured in the above step decide how it is to be tested
  • Modify the existing test cases and library to enhance and support new features using Python
  • Maintaining the products ENS 10.7, ENS 10.6.1, WSS, Mvision, Tie for Vse
  • Maintain and manage changes in running environments

Associate Software Engineer

Mphasis India Pvt. Ltd.
Bangalore
04.2019 - 05.2021
  • Storage Test Automation is targeted for end-to-end testing of Storage Devices on HP ProLiant servers connected to controllers (Smart Array, Smart HBA)
  • This is DAS environment, and automation primarily involves validating various HP controllers and Storage boxes with different combination of servers and operating system
  • This involves development of test cases on Raid creation, Raid migration, logical drive extends, Array Expand, Stripe size Migration, move Lun, MSA provisioning, failing a logical drive, Smart cache switching modes
  • SPP is software provided by HP to support NIC adapters and storage controllers, which include drivers and firmware for different Vendors to test on different flavor of OSs

Education

Bachelor of Engineering - Computer Science

Institute of Information Technology & Management (IITM)
Gwalior, MP
01.2018

Skills

  • Python automation scripting
  • Robot Framework
  • API testing and Postman
  • Functional, regression, and system testing
  • Sanity testing
  • Cloud computing with GCP
  • Virtualization with VMware vCenter
  • Version control with Git
  • Continuous integration with Jenkins
  • Project management with Jira and Confluence
  • Remote access with Putty
  • Development environments: Visual Studio and PyCharm
  • Hardware management: HP DL/ML/BL, RAID, HDD, SSD, NVMe

Languages

  • English
  • Hindi

Personal Information

  • Date of Birth: 11/20/97
  • Marital Status: Married

Timeline

Software Quality Engineer

McAfee Software India Pvt. Ltd
06.2021 - Current

Software QA Engineer

McAfee Software India Pvt. Ltd
06.2021 - 03.2023

Associate Software Engineer

Mphasis India Pvt. Ltd.
04.2019 - 05.2021

Bachelor of Engineering - Computer Science

Institute of Information Technology & Management (IITM)
Himanshu Gupta